- Major FunPart 2 for 800 Medicare number:
Heavy Indian accent rep from Medicare wanting to verify my SS info so he can send my new plastic Medicare card. I’m shocked he knew my address and date of birth. Didn’t sound legit, so I played with him for awhile. Said he was in D.C. but caller ID said Detroit, asked his address he gives 16 Pennsylvania Ave. which comes up as a house. The 313-497-5639 line disconnects and he calls back and ID says 800-MEDICARE (800-633-4227). Asked him to give me last 4 numbers and I’d give him the first five, he got confused and said he didn’t have that number and I asked how then can you confirm it? He said he was going to disenroll me from Medicare, for life… ok I said.- Caller: Indian accent guy
